Northern Corridor Highway through Red Cliffs National Conservation Area
Case: Conserve Southwest Utah, Conservation Lands Foundation, Center for Biological Diversity, Defenders of Wildlife, Southern Utah Wilderness Alliance, The Wilderness Society, and WildEarth Guardians v. U.S. Department of the Interior and Bureau of Land Management
January 21, 2026 — The Bureau of Land Management (BLM) re-approved a proposal from the Utah Department of Transportation (UDOT), at the behest of Washington County, for the construction of a four-lane Northern Corridor Highway through the Red Cliffs National Conservation Area near St. George, Utah. San Pedro Riparian National Conservation Area Grazing
Case: Western Watersheds Project, Center for Biological Diversity, and Sierra Club v. Anthony (Scott) Feldhausen, BLM Arizona State Director, and Bureau of Land Management
August 1, 2022 — Advocates for the West filed a settlement agreement sending the Bureau of Land Management back to its planning desk to reconsider the impacts of livestock grazing on the San Pedro Riparian National Conservation Area. Sage-Grouse Land Use Plans
Case: Center for Biological Diversity, Gallatin Wildlife Association, Great Old Broads for Wilderness, Rocky Mountain Wild, Sierra Club, Western Watersheds Project, and WildEarth Guardians vs. Bureau of Land Management
March 2, 2026 — Advocates for the West and our conservation partners sued the Bureau of Land Management to challenge its final plans governing greater sage-grouse management across 71 million acres of federal public lands in nine Western states. Coolin Wetlands Clean Water Act Violations
Case: N/A
December 23, 2025 — Representing Idaho Conservation League, Advocates for the West sent a 60-day Notice of Intent to Sue over Clean Water Act (CWA) violations to Tricore Investments, LLC and company associates for unlawfully excavating a channel in the Coolin Wetlands on the south shore of Priest Lake in northern Idaho. Trestle Creek Commercial Marina and Luxury Housing
Case: Center for Biological Diversity and Idaho Conservation League v. U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service; U.S. Army Corps of Engineers
December 23, 2025 — In response to our litigation, the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ers ordered the Idaho Club to stop construction on a commercial marina and lakeside housing development at the mouth of Trestle Creek on Lake Pend Oreille.
